Tech Note: Embedding Audio, Video and Image Content

A place for Do it Yourself projects

Moderator: Moderators

Tech Note: Embedding Audio, Video and Image Content

Postby mrpicard » Sat Mar 07, 2009 9:33 am

One of the purposes of the BJFE Forum is to share our experiences with BJ's pedals. To this end I have extended the forum to support the embedding of audio and video content directly into a message. These new types are:

Audio
  • MP3 clips
  • SoundCloud clips
  • MySpace music
  • SoundClick songs
  • SoundClick bands
Video
  • Google videos
  • MySpace videos
  • Photobucket videos
  • YouTube movies (standard and widescreen)
Photographs
  • BJFE Forum Gallery
  • MobileMe Web Gallery
  • Picasa Web Album Slideshow (RSS Feed)
  • Photobucket Slideshow

The sections below covers each media type and describes:

  1. Purpose: The purpose of the embedded media player
  2. Example: An example of what the embedded media player looks like once it is embedded in a message
  3. Code: The specific code used to create the example
  4. Explanation: Further details on the coding

  MP3 Clips  

Purpose:
Play an MP3 file located at a URL.

Example:

Code:
[mp3]http://www.ufoclub.it/synphoton.mp3[/mp3]

Explanation:
The text between the [mp3] tags must be the URL pointing to the MP3 file to be played.



  SoundCloud Clips  

Purpose:
Play a single, specific audio file held on http://www.soundcloud.com.

Example:

Code:
[soundcloud]http://soundcloud.com/dsong/bjf-syod-egdm-dhbod-demo-3-26-10-1[/soundcloud]

Explanation:
The text between the [soundcloud] tags refers to the individual SoundCloud audio file, available from the SoundCloud web site. This particular example plays demos of the SYOD, HBOD DLX and EGDM pedals played by melodichaotic.




  MySpace Music  

Purpose:
Load and play the audio files for a MySpace artist.

Example:
Oops! In order to listen to this, you will need to enable JavaScript and install Adobe Flash 9 or greater. Get Flash now!

Code:
[myspaceaudio=36878,42831392,8944963][/myspaceaudio]

Explanation:
The three variables in the [myspaceaudio] tag are the plid (player id), profid (profile id) and artid (artistid) taken from the MySpace artist profile. All these codes must match the artist MySpace codes and must be separated by commas.



  SoundClick Songs  

Purpose:
Play a single, specific song held on http://www.soundclick.com.

Example:

Code:
[soundclicksingle]3661654[/soundclicksingle]

Explanation:
The text between the [soundclicksingle] tags refers to the individual SoundClick Song ID, available from the SoundClick web site. This particular example plays the "BJF Tea Green EQ (Amp Cranked)" song created by the artist Teahouse.



  SoundClick Band  

Purpose:
Load and play the audio files for a SoundClick band.

Example:

Code:
[soundclickband=Teahead]361669[/soundclickband]

Explanation:
The parameter in the [soundclickband] tag provides the band's name to appear in the media player. The number between the [soundclickband] tags refers to the band ID, available from the SoundClick web site. This particular example displays the songs for the band Teahead.



  Google Videos  

Purpose:
Load and play Google videos.

Example:

Code:
[googlevideo]8035933373921884072[/googlevideo]

Explanation:
The text between the [googlevideo] tags refers to the Google video ID. This particular example points to Fatback demonstrating the Rocketride SD-1.




  MySpace Videos  

Purpose:
Load and play MySpace videos.

Example:

Code:
[myspacevideo]18665197[/myspacevideo]

Explanation:
The number between the [myspacevideo] tags refers to the MySpace Video ID. This particular example shows a certain pedal builder letting his hair down.



  PhotoBucket Videos  

Purpose:
Load and play PhotoBucket videos.

Example:

Code:
[photobucketvideo]http://vid246.photobucket.com/albums/gg89/reza_m/Music/led_zeppelin_-_dazed_and_confused.flv[/photobucketvideo]

Explanation:
The text between the [photobucketvideo] tags refers to the PhotoBucket video URL. This particular example points a Led Zeppelin video.



  YouTube Videos  

Purpose:
Load and play YouTube videos.

Example:

Code:
[youtube]87yq372R4Ts[/youtube]

Explanation:
The text between the [youtube] tags refers to the YouTube video ID. This particular example points to The Beatles playing "Revolution".



  YouTube Widescreen Videos  

Purpose:
Load and play widescreen YouTube videos.

Example:

Code:
[youtube-wide]mItU2k48kWo[/youtube-wide]

Explanation:
The text between the [youtube-wide] tags refers to the widescreen YouTube video ID. This particular example points to Linkin Park playing "Faint".



  BJFE Forum Gallery  

Purpose:
Display a photograph in the BJFE Forum Gallery. The post will show a thumbnail of the image that when you click on will display the large version of the photograph. An alternative is to simply embed the Image-URL or Image BBCode presented on the image details in the BJFE Forum Gallery and this will operate as a standard image tag.

Example:
17

Code:
[album]17[/album]

Explanation:
The text between the [album] tags refers to the BJFE Forum Gallery photo ID. This particular example provides a link to the BJFE Reference Gallery Dyna Red Distortion photograph.



  MobileMe Web Gallery  

Purpose:
Provide an interactive link to a MobileMe Web Gallery. When loaded, this object will cycle though the photographs help in the library. However, if you drag the mouse over the viewer you can view individual photos. If you then click on the individual photo a window will open with that photo enlarged. Alternatively, you can click the arrow at the bottom of the object to go the complete gallery.

Example:

Code:
[mobilemegallery=mrpicard]100335[/mobilemegallery]

Explanation:
The parameter in the [mobilemegallery] tag refers to the MobileMe user name and the text in between the [mobilemegallery] tags refers to the MobileMe Album ID. This particular example provides a link to a presentation by mrpicard of BJFE pedals.



  Picasa Web Album Slideshow  

Purpose:
Load and play a Picasa slideshow RSS feed. Because this is a RSS feed this means that the display will always update with the new photos in the album. If you press the play button the presentation will cycle through the photos. However, if you click on a specific photo that photo will then open in a completely new window.

Example:

Code:
[picasaweb=picardviews]5311552222369954449[/picasaweb]

Explanation:
The parameter in the [picasaweb] tag refers to the Picasa user name and the text in between the [picasaweb] tags refers to the RSS album ID. This particular example points to a nice presentation by user picardviews showing BJFE Pedals.



  Photobucket Slideshow  

Purpose:
Load and run a Photobucket slideshow

Example:

Code:
[photobucketslide]http://w219.photobucket.com/albums/cc60/virtualviews/a698ba77.pbw[/photobucketslide]

Explanation:
The value between the [photobucketslide]tags refers to the URL to the slideshow. This particular example runs the slideshow at http://w219.photobucket.com/albums/cc60 ... 98ba77.pbw.

User avatar
mrpicard
 
Posts: 306
Images: 377
Joined: Mon May 19, 2008 11:48 pm
Location: Sydney, Australia
pedals: 24

Return to Folk Forum (DIY projects)

Who is online

Users browsing this forum: No registered users and 1 guest